Harmful algal blooms (HAB’s) are a fast-spreading hazard across the U.S. These blooms are responsible for major damages to the economy, health, and environment of many Americans. In this research, I focused on finding a targeted concentration of H2o2 depending on the severity of algal blooms. First, I diluted the 12% concentration of H2O2 into 2 other concentrations (0.3%, 6%). Secondly, I diluted 10ml of each concentration on 65ml of distilled water. Then, I microencapsulated the concentrations by adding 0.75g of sodium alginate in 10ml of distilled water, waiting for it to thicken up and add it in 75ml of water. I also dissolved 20g of calcium chloride in 600ml of distilled water and placed it in a cold bath. To finish up the microencapsulation process, I collected the prepared solutions and using a syringe I dropped them into the calcium chloride solution, creating algicide beads. Ten milliliters of algicide beads were added to 100ml of spirulina. Mg-11nutrient medium was added to simulate real-world aquatic conditions, and a heat pad was used to maintain temperature between 25-27°C. Results were measured using a Vernier Go Direct UV-vis spectrophotometer. After analyzing the results of the experiment, data gathered demonstrated that a controlled, low dose H2o2 treatment like 0.3% can mitigate harmful algal blooms more safely, whereas a higher dosage like 6% may cause a more rapid, necrotic-like cellular disruption. The 0.3% concentration is fit for moderate HAB’s, as it reduces bloom growth while avoiding excessive DNA damage observed at higher concentrations. In contrast, a higher concentration like 6% was more effective at rapidly suppressing algal growth, making it ideal for severe bloom cases. However, this concentration caused significantly more cellular damage, indicating that it should be reserved for situations where aggressive intervention is necessary.
